EU Launches Biometric Entry System, Anticipates Travel Delays

Story summary
- The European Union's Entry/Exit System (EES) launched on October 12, 2025, requiring non-EU travelers to register biometric data.
- The EES replaces manual passport stamping and will streamline border checks across 29 countries.
- Registration involves scanning passports, fingerprints, and facial images, and is valid for three years.
- Initial rollout may cause delays at busy ports like Dover and Eurostar, as checks begin before departure from the United Kingdom.
